Top Powerful Biblical Boy Names and Their Meanings

Here are some of the most powerful and meaningful biblical boy names, along with their meanings and significance:

1. Noah

Noah is a name that has gained popularity in recent years. It means "rest" or "comfort" and is associated with the biblical figure who built an ark to save his family and the animals from the great flood. Noah's story is one of faith, obedience, and perseverance.

2. Elijah

Elijah means "Yahweh is my God" and is the name of a prominent prophet in the Old Testament. Known for his miracles and his dramatic ascent to heaven in a chariot of fire, Elijah is a name that signifies strength and divine connection.

3. Samuel

Samuel means "name of God" or "heard by God." In the Bible, Samuel was a judge and prophet who anointed the first kings of Israel. His name is associated with wisdom, leadership, and divine guidance.

4. Daniel

Daniel means "God is my judge" and is the name of a wise and faithful servant of God who was thrown into a lion's den but miraculously survived. Daniel's story is one of courage, faith, and integrity.

5. Joshua

Joshua means "Yahweh is salvation" and is the name of Moses' successor who led the Israelites into the Promised Land. Joshua's name signifies leadership, courage, and the fulfillment of divine promises.

6. David

David means "beloved" and is one of the most famous biblical names. King David was a shepherd, poet, and warrior who united the tribes of Israel and established Jerusalem as its capital. His name is synonymous with strength, wisdom, and musical talent.

7. Isaac

Isaac means "he will laugh" and is the name of Abraham's son, who was born to Sarah in her old age. Isaac's story is one of faith, miracles, and the fulfillment of God's promises. His name signifies joy and divine intervention.

8. Caleb

Caleb means "devotion to God" and is the name of one of the twelve spies sent to explore the Promised Land. Caleb was known for his faith and courage, and he was one of the few who believed in God's promise to give the land to the Israelites.

9. Moses

Moses means "drawn out" and is the name of the prophet who led the Israelites out of slavery in Egypt. Moses is a symbol of leadership, faith, and divine intervention. His name signifies deliverance and the fulfillment of God's promises.

10. Jonah

Jonah means "dove" and is the name of the prophet who was swallowed by a whale and later preached to the people of Nineveh. Jonah's story is one of obedience, repentance, and divine mercy.

Here is a table of some popular biblical boy names along with their meanings and origins:

Name Meaning Origin
Noah Rest, comfort Hebrew
Elijah Yahweh is my God Hebrew
Samuel Name of God, heard by God Hebrew
Daniel God is my judge Hebrew
Joshua Yahweh is salvation Hebrew
David Beloved Hebrew
Isaac He will laugh Hebrew
Caleb Devotion to God Hebrew
Moses Drawn out Hebrew
Jonah Dove Hebrew

📝 Note: The meanings and origins of these names can vary slightly depending on the source, but the above information is generally accepted.
